Chicken Sausage and Broccoli Orzo – Quick, Easy, and Packed with Flavor

A delicious and quick one-pot meal featuring chicken sausage, tender orzo, and vibrant broccoli, perfect for busy weeknights.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 400

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 12 oz chicken sausage sliced
  • 1 cup orzo pasta
  • 2 cups broccoli florets fresh or frozen
  • 4 cups chicken broth low sodium
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ic minced
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Method
 

Cooking the Sausage and Broccoli
  1.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the sliced chicken sausage and cook until browned, about 5 minutes.
  2. Add the minced garlic and Italian seasoning, stirring for about 1 minute until fragrant.
  3. Stir in the broccoli florets and cook for another 2 minutes.
Cooking the Orzo
  1.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a boil.
  2. Add the orzo pasta and reduce heat to a simmer. Cook for 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the orzo is tender and the liquid is mostly absorbed.
Finishing Touches
  1.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ve hot, garnished with grated Parmesan cheese if desired.
